Are people in Norwell older or younger than people in Coraopolis?
- The Median Age in Norwell is 2.8 years older than in Coraopolis.

Are housing costs cheaper in Norwell or Coraopolis?
- Norwell housing costs are 224.2% more expensive than Coraopolis hous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Norwell or Coraopolis?
- The average commute for residents of Norwell is 14.1 minutes longer than it is for residents of Coraopolis.
